Unfortunately, the onus of ensuring a clean car lies with the customer. That's precisely why we insist on every car buyer using the PDI Checklist. With the highest discipline. 60 minutes on the PDI can save you 60 cumulative days in the courts.

Message Displayed on the banner of my car for Saturday road show goes like this -

BEWARE!!!
CONCORDE MOTORS SELLS REPAINTED CAR
Dear All, I purchased a Brand New Car Fiat Palio from Concorde Motors, Bangalore. Later it was found that the car has been repainted in Rear Left Side Door & Door Handle, Left & Right Side of the Fender, Under the Bonnet. So beware when you purchase brand new car from Concorde Motors, Bangalore. For more details please read BangaloreMirror dated July 12, 2010 page No.7
-Owner of the Defect Car
